Analysis Finds False Dosage Labels On Most Amazon Hemp And CBD Products

Veriheal

Selling hemp, CBD (cannabidiol), and THC (tetrahydrocannabinol) products on Amazon’s marketplace is prohibited, but that hasn’t stopped sellers from finding ways to circumvent this policy. One such company, CBD Oracle, has recently analyzed a variety of CBD and hemp products available for sale on Amazon.

OLCC Expands Recall of Cura Select Tinctures Tincture labeled as containing THC doesn’t contain THC

Cannabis Law Report

The Oregon Liquor and Cannabis Commission is expanding its recall of Select brand tincture products produced by Cura CS, LLC. The recall expansion now includes Select Tincture 30mL THC Drops – 1000mg Unflavored which is only available for sale at OLCC licensed retailers.

Cannabis Tinctures Are Now Back with Legalization

Puff Puff Post

Cannabis tinctures are potions of cannabis in an alcohol base. The same alcohol we drink cannabis enthusiasts use to extract THC. There was a long history of using cannabis tinctures, especially for medical purposes. The first known users of cannabis tinctures in the West were in the Roman Empire.
